The Spurs legend, who played and coached Tottenham Hotspur, said the star striker has got the right to consider leaving.

Tottenham legend Glenn Hoddle admits that Harry Kane may leave the club this summer and believes that the “chess game” featuring Manchester City, Real Madrid, Kylian Mbappe and Erling Haaland could lead Tottenham Hotspur at PSG. A huge transfer is expected during the summer transfer window, and Harry Kane’s name is under discussion as Tottenham strives to realize his personal ambitions.

Glenn Hoddle says the England captain deserves the right to consider leaving the London club. Former Tottenham Hotspur player and coach Hoddle told the Evening Standard: “I don’t know if it’s in Tottenham’s hands, I think it’s Harry Kane’s decision. Nobody will blame Harry Kane if he moves now if he says, ‘I’m going to win titles elsewhere’” and that’s the right offer there, he’ll make that decision and then Tottenham will have to get Best.

“It would be a big blow for the team. There are only a few clubs that can afford Harry Kane’s signature, that’s his problem now. There could be a game of chess – if Erling Haaland goes. At Manchester City and Kylian Mbappe go to Real Madrid, maybe there is a chance.” He’s in Paris Saint-Germain, I don’t want to see him in Paris Saint-Germain, I would love to see him stay in Tottenham, but I wouldn’t blame him for ‘he was going somewhere else’The former Tottenham coach added.

Will Kane stay in Tottenham?

The 27-year-old is on contract in North London until 2024, after remaining firmly loyal to the club. However, it is impossible to escape the fact that the man who scored 217 goals for Tottenham had yet to put his hands on the trophy during his career. The Carabao Cup final against Manchester City on April 25 could put an end to this fruitless round, but it remains to be seen whether the outcome of this match will determine where Kane will play next season.
